Kuwait Oil Company Explores Renewable Energy And Green Hydrogen Transition

30 April 2024 Kuwait

In a significant move towards sustainability, Kuwait Oil Company (KOC) has entered into an agreement with KBR Consulting to conduct a feasibility study on transitioning to renewable energy and green hydrogen.

This strategic initiative is in line with Kuwait Petroleum Corporation’s (KPC) commitment to achieving carbon neutrality by 2050, as articulated by KPC CEO Sheikh Nawaf Al-Saud.

A coordination meeting convened between KOC and KBR officials to outline the project’s roadmap. The KOC delegation comprised Hamad Al-Zaabi, Group Manager of Innovation and Technology; Mohammed Al-Aqab, Head of Research and Technology Team; Nasser Boutaleb, Head of Project Management Consultant Contracts Team; Nahed Al-Hajri, Head of Project Management Team (35); and Dr. Hussein Arab, Chief Consultant.

Kuwait is actively pursuing environmental projects, particularly with KPC and its subsidiaries launching their strategic plan in this area and their commitment to achieving carbon neutrality in the oil and gas sector.

KOC’s comprehensive strategy encompasses exploration, production, energy transition, and drilling, both onshore and offshore. This integrated approach is aligned with the overarching strategy of KPC and its subsidiaries, facilitating Kuwait’s oil strategy under the coordinated leadership of KPC and its subsidiaries.
